Snowy owls nest in the Arctic tundra of the of Alaska, Canada, and Eurasia. In the winter they travel south through Canada and northern Eurasia. Snowy owls are attracted to open areas like coastal dunes that appear similar to tundra.

The snowy owl, also known as the Arctic Owl, Great White Owl, or Harfang, lives mostly in northern regions close to the north pole, usually in cold snowy climates where its white feathers will allow it to blend in with its surroundings.
